Abstract
The utility model relates to a bolt and a nut, particularly a built-in bolt which is provided with the bolt and the nut. The bolt comprises a bolt head and a bolt rod part, and the bolt rod part is provided with a front rod part and a back rod part. The cross-section of the front rod part is in the shape of a ratchet wheel, and the back rod part is provided with screw threads. The nut is provided with a front nut and a back nut, the outside of the screw hole of the front nut is provided with a pair of detents, and one end of each of the detents is provided with a replacement spring. The detents are engaged with the ratchet wheels on the front rod part, and the screw hole of the back nut is engaged with the screw threads on the back rod part. Because the bolt uses two sections of different structures (the ratchet wheels and the screw thread), and the nut correspondingly uses two sections of different structures (the detents and the screw thread), the looseness and falling off of the bolt can be prevented; in addition, through different detent structures, a movable and openable bolt against reverse, looseness and dropping off can be made, as well as a fixed and permanent bolt against reverse, looseness and dropping off can also be made.
Description
(1) technical field
The utility model relates to a kind of screw and nut, especially a kind of built-in bolt.
(2) background technique
Existing bolt is made up of screw, nut, is a kind of important fastening Component.But time one is long, and traditional bolt is on the object of motion because vibration, tend to produce loosening, thereby easy to wear, come off, often lead to major accident and unnecessary loss.Some traditional connection sets particularly, the requirement height of fastening and precision pressure, if adopt electric welding to weld, gap enlargement can not be tightened solid again more in the future; If adopt latch fastening, same easily loosening, and screw rod too short not inserting when getting into the cave is oversize inaccurate again.At present, many communal facilitys in city such as power transformer, sewer cover, license plate and other various machinery, also because of adopting general bolt, and stolen in a large number, because only need common small wrench just can steal easily to general bolt.
(3) summary of the invention
The utility model aims to provide a kind of loose or dislocation that is difficult for, and it is loosening or select permanent fastening built-in bolt also can to select to open anti-retrogression according to demand.
Built-in bolt is provided with screw and nut, and screw comprises screw head and screw part, bar portion and back bar portion before screw part is established, and the cross section of preceding bar portion is ratchet shape, and back bar portion is threaded.Nut and back nut before nut is established, a pair of ratchet is established in the screw outside of preceding nut, and an end of ratchet is established Returnning spring, and ratchet matches with the ratchet of preceding bar portion, and the screw of back nut is identical with the screw thread of back bar portion; The other end of ratchet can be fixed or movable, for stationary structure, in the groove before the other end of ratchet is located at outside the nut screw; For movable structure, in the cavity before the other end of ratchet is located at outside the nut screw, ratchet can rotate around jack shaft, and cavity is to preceding nut peripheral hardware penetration hole, in the time of need opening nut with box lunch, only need 1 shaft, the ratchet of ratchet in the preceding nut and screw can be thrown off, to dismantle down bolt.
In order not influence the fastness of bolt, the ratchet of screw part (preceding bar portion) should be than helical thread portion (back bar portion) overstriking, and preceding nut should strengthen, thicken than back nut, so that enough space mounting ratchets are arranged, assurance has enough fastness.
Because screw adopts two sections different structures (ratchet and screw thread), nut is corresponding also to adopt two sections different structures (ratchet and screw thread), so the utility model can prevent loose or dislocation.Pass through different pawl structures, the bolt that makes the utility model both can make movable openable anti-retrogression, become flexible, come off, the bolt that also can make fixed permanent anti-retrogression, becomes flexible, comes off in addition.

(5) embodiment
Embodiment 1: shown in Fig. 1~4, the utility model is provided with screw 1 and nut 2, and screw 1 comprises screw head 11, preceding bar portion 12 and back bar portion 13, and the cross section of preceding bar portion 12 is ratchet shape, and back bar portion 13 is threaded.Nut 21 and back nut 22 before nut 2 comprises, 1 pair of ratchet 23 is established in screw 211 outsides of preceding nut 21, and an end of ratchet 23 is established Returnning spring 24, and ratchet 23 matches with the ratchet 14 of preceding bar portion 12, and the screw 221 of back nut 22 coincide with the screw thread of back bar portion 13.Before equal big than back nut of diameter and thickness of nut.
Embodiment 2: as shown in Figure 5, present embodiment is made balanced type with different ratchets 26 of preceding nut 21 that are of the embodiment 1, one end 261 is established Returnning spring 24, the other end 262 is movable, movable axis 27 is established in the centre of ratchet 26, ratchet can rotate in the outboard chambers 28 of preceding nut screw 211 freely, and to preceding nut peripheral hardware penetration hole 29, penetration hole 29 communicates with 262 ends of ratchet 26 at cavity 28.Only need depress ratchet end 262, just can make ratchet 14 disengagements of ratchet 26 and preceding bar portion, open bolt again with a shaft.
